Was your starting Android version 9? Otherwise, you won’t have the WiFi drivers. I just did this and I couldn’t get it to work with Android 10 until I tried version 9.

….as it turned out, i dowgraded to vers.9 ,and voilá, everything works like a charm.WiFi,Tethering, GPS all ok now.One problem remains. After a phonecall i lose Network for a minute or two. otherwise it looks adhequit.
I just found out that when making calls, if set to 3G only, the service runs normally without losing the Network. So 4G is out of the question until the problems are solved .Lets hope developing reads this message ! Kap’La!
